The Japanese government has begun its ordinary parliament session, which is called the Diet. Japanese Prime Minister Shinzo Abe is expected to give his policy speech during the session. The session is scheduled to last for 150 days, until June 22nd. Abe’s policy speech and three other government policy statements are expected on the first day of the session.
